How do French people celebrate advent?

There are not much celebrations for Advent period in France. There are additional masses for the keener church-goers. In many families though, kids get an Advent calendar shaped like a house with many windows. You open a window each day and find a small chocolate inside. Kids may also prepare the Nativity scene, setting first the ox, then the family (some used to make the family "travel" through the room to the scene), then Christ on December 25th.

What is the difference between a lunar calendar and a Gregorian?

A lunar calendar is based on the movements of the Moon. It is a general description of a type of calendar. There are many lunar calendars. The Gregorian Calendar is one particular calendar. It was established by Pope Gregory XIII, who introduced it in 1582. It is the calendar that much of the world now uses.
